Subject: [PATCH v12 4/8] mm/demotion/dax/kmem: Set node's abstract distance to MEMTIER_ADISTANCE_PMEM
Date: Fri, 29 Jul 2022 11:43:45 +0530	[thread overview]
Message-ID: <20220729061349.968148-5-aneesh.kumar@linux.ibm.com> (raw)
In-Reply-To: <20220729061349.968148-1-aneesh.kumar@linux.ibm.com>

By default, all nodes are assigned to the default memory tier which
is the memory tier designated for nodes with DRAM

Set dax kmem device node's tier to slower memory tier by assigning
abstract distance to MEMTIER_ADISTANCE_PMEM. PMEM tier
appears below the default memory tier in demotion order.

diff --git a/drivers/dax/kmem.c b/drivers/dax/kmem.c
index a37622060fff..6b0d5de9a3e9 100644
--- a/drivers/dax/kmem.c
+++ b/drivers/dax/kmem.c
@@ -11,6 +11,7 @@
 #include <linux/fs.h>
 #include <linux/mm.h>
 #include <linux/mman.h>
+#include <linux/memory-tiers.h>
 #include "dax-private.h"
 #include "bus.h"
 
@@ -41,6 +42,12 @@ struct dax_kmem_data {
 	struct resource *res[];
 };
 
+static struct memory_dev_type default_pmem_type  = {
+	.adistance = MEMTIER_ADISTANCE_PMEM,
+	.tier_sibiling = LIST_HEAD_INIT(default_pmem_type.tier_sibiling),
+	.nodes  = NODE_MASK_NONE,
+};
+
 static int dev_dax_kmem_probe(struct dev_dax *dev_dax)
 {
 	struct device *dev = &dev_dax->dev;
@@ -62,6 +69,8 @@ static int dev_dax_kmem_probe(struct dev_dax *dev_dax)
 		return -EINVAL;
 	}
 
+	init_node_memory_type(numa_node, &default_pmem_type);
+
 	for (i = 0; i < dev_dax->nr_range; i++) {
 		struct range range;
 
diff --git a/include/linux/memory-tiers.h b/include/linux/memory-tiers.h
index eeb4b045e631..c25f385ff9a8 100644
--- a/include/linux/memory-tiers.h
+++ b/include/linux/memory-tiers.h
@@ -2,6 +2,8 @@
 #ifndef _LINUX_MEMORY_TIERS_H
 #define _LINUX_MEMORY_TIERS_H
 
+#include <linux/types.h>
+#include <linux/nodemask.h>
 /*
  * Each tier cover a abstrace distance chunk size of 128
  */
@@ -14,12 +16,27 @@
 #define MEMTIER_ADISTANCE_PMEM	(1 << (MEMTIER_CHUNK_BITS + 3))
 #define MEMTIER_HOTPLUG_PRIO	100
 
+struct memory_tier;
+struct memory_dev_type {
+	/* list of memory types that are are part of same tier as this type */
+	struct list_head tier_sibiling;
+	/* abstract distance for this specific memory type */
+	int adistance;
+	/* Nodes of same abstract distance */
+	nodemask_t nodes;
+	struct memory_tier *memtier;
+};
+
 #ifdef CONFIG_NUMA
-#include <linux/types.h>
 extern bool numa_demotion_enabled;
+struct memory_dev_type *init_node_memory_type(int node, struct memory_dev_type *default_type);
 
 #else
 
 #define numa_demotion_enabled	false
+static inline struct memory_dev_type *init_node_memory_type(int node, struct memory_dev_type *default_type)
+{
+	return ERR_PTR(-EINVAL);
+}
 #endif	/* CONFIG_NUMA */
 #endif  /* _LINUX_MEMORY_TIERS_H */
diff --git a/mm/memory-tiers.c b/mm/memory-tiers.c
index 0a7a79cad2a0..0c4394975d1d 100644
--- a/mm/memory-tiers.c
+++ b/mm/memory-tiers.c
@@ -1,6 +1,4 @@
 // SPDX-License-Identifier: GPL-2.0
-#include <linux/types.h>
-#include <linux/nodemask.h>
 #include <linux/slab.h>
 #include <linux/lockdep.h>
 #include <linux/sysfs.h>
@@ -21,16 +19,6 @@ struct memory_tier {
 	int adistance_start;
 };
 
-struct memory_dev_type {
-	/* list of memory types that are are part of same tier as this type */
-	struct list_head tier_sibiling;
-	/* abstract distance for this specific memory type */
-	int adistance;
-	/* Nodes of same abstract distance */
-	nodemask_t nodes;
-	struct memory_tier *memtier;
-};
-
 static DEFINE_MUTEX(memory_tier_lock);
 static LIST_HEAD(memory_tiers);
 struct memory_dev_type *node_memory_types[MAX_NUMNODES];
@@ -143,6 +131,22 @@ static void clear_node_memory_tier(int node)
 	mutex_unlock(&memory_tier_lock);
 }
 
+struct memory_dev_type *init_node_memory_type(int node, struct memory_dev_type *default_type)
+{
+	struct memory_dev_type *mem_type;
+
+	mutex_lock(&memory_tier_lock);
+	if (node_memory_types[node]) {
+		mem_type = node_memory_types[node];
+	} else {
+		node_memory_types[node] = default_type;
+		node_set(node, default_type->nodes);
+		mem_type = default_type;
+	}
+	mutex_unlock(&memory_tier_lock);
+	return mem_type;
+}
+
 static int __meminit memtier_hotplug_callback(struct notifier_block *self,
 					      unsigned long action, void *_arg)
 {
